Are you anxious about what 2024 will bring? Are you anxious about your future or your family? We all worry, no matter how strong our faith is in God. We get overwhelmed by stress at work, juggling schedules, knowing what will come in times of uncertainty.

But, the Bible is so clear that there’s no need to worry. Look at our anchor verse from the Gospel of Matthew: “So do not worry, saying, ‘What shall we eat?’ or ‘What shall we drink?’ or ‘What shall we wear?’ For the pagans run after all these things, and your heavenly Father knows that you need them. But seek first his kingdom and his righteousness, and all these things will be given to you as well. Therefore do not worry about tomorrow, for tomorrow will worry about itself. Each day has enough trouble of its own.” - Matthew 6:31-34

Matthew says to seek first God and his kingdom, and everything else will sort itself out. Notice that Jesus doesn’t say all of these things going on in your life aren’t important. Instead, he says fix your eyes on the thing that is most important. Jesus reminds us that God will carry the burdens and challenges we face. God cares about all of the things going on in our lives because he loves us so deeply.

Knowing God is in control, is not the same as allowing God to take control. Every challenge you face can be a “let go, let God” moment. When we seek God first, we make God the first part of our lives, by giving Him the first of our lives. One way we can seek God first, is by committing to fasting and praying. We encourage you to start the New Year with a 21-day fast to help you focus on God, and fight back against everyday stresses, worry and anxiety.
